Due to even more demand, Obama rally at Madison has moved again
I just got word that the demand for people wanting to see Barack Obama in Madison on October 15th is even more than what they predicted and the new venue (which holds up to 40,000 people) is now at the Monona Terrace.

Madison Countdown to Change
Monday, October 15th
Doors open at 10:30 a.m.

Monona Terrace Community and Convention Center
One John Nolen Dr.
Madison, WI 53703
